Singer Bryson Tiller has goals and in order to reach those goals, he had to handle some unfinished business. Look at him now: A high school graduate and one step closer to making some of his dreams come true. The 27-year-old singer recently received his diploma from Iroquois High School, which is in his hometown of Louisville, Kentucky.
The Trapsoul singer hopped on Twitter to share a picture of his name amongst the high school Class of 2020 graduates. He also said college is absolutely next on his to-do list.
Class of 2020 I never thought about going back to school until i started thinking about my goals and how to reach them. getting my High School diploma was step 1 College is 100% next. thank you IHS & @JCPSKY pic.twitter.com/x3z0WO03Rm
— tiller (@brysontiller) June 25, 2020
Since the COVID-19 pandemic canceled his graduation ceremony, he celebrated with his family at home. Dressed in a cap and gown, he walked out and waved at his family as they announced his name on a microphone.
“I graduated high school!” he shouted. Then, he tossed his cap in the air. Check it:
